Angolan Batis vs Bar-tailed Trogon
Batis minulla compared with Apaloderma vittatum
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Angolan Batis | Bar-tailed Trogon |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Aves (Birds)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Passeriformes (Songbirds) | Trogoniformes (Trogoniformes) |
| Family | Platysteiridae | Trogonidae |
| Genus | Batis | Apaloderma |
| Species | Batis minulla | Apaloderma vittatum |
Evolutionary Relationship
Angolan Batis and Bar-tailed Trogon share a common ancestor at the Class level: Aves. (Birds)
